  7. Check the ground on the left front run/turn light. If ground is faulty the run light may be seeking ground through the turn filament. This can cause all kinda weird things.

  19. Cut an oval piece of galvanized sheet metal. The small diameter is just small enough to go in the hole in the roof. The long diameter will be larger than the hole in the roof. Drill a small hole in the middle of the metal oval and put a stiff wire through the hole and bend it over so the metal oval is hooked to it. Now feed the oval through the hole in the roof and hold it up against the underside of the hole in the roof, with the stiff wire. From here, you can use solder to attach the oval to the underside of the roof and also fill in the hole. I guess you could also use some of today's high strength adhesive instead of solder. Level the hole with body filler, sand prime and paint.
